l shaped outdoor kitchen with bar plans Orange County FL
Drafting comprehensive L-shaped outdoor kitchen with bar plans is key to designing a functional space. Your plans should begin with accurate space measurements, ensuring adequate clearance for walkways and seating. The layout must specify precise appliance locations, ensuring proper workflow with all gas, electrical, and plumbing needs. For the bar section, determine the bar height, usually near 42 inches for seating comfort, and the desired overhang for minimally 10 inches for seated guests. Detailed plans should also map out electrical outlets for blenders or speakers, and include a lighting scheme to create the right ambiance after sunset.

l shaped outdoor kitchen layout Orange County FL
The success of any outdoor kitchen hinges on its design, and the L-shaped outdoor kitchen layout is a proven winner in terms of pure efficiency. This layout specializes in creating clearly defined functional zones: a 'hot zone' for the grill and side burners, a 'cold zone' for the refrigerator, a 'wet zone' for the sink, and a 'prep zone' with ample counter space. The 'L' shape allows these zones to be arranged in a cohesive sequence that follows the natural flow of cooking, from gathering ingredients to washing, prepping, cooking, and serving. This thoughtful arrangement minimizes unnecessary movement, keeping everything the chef needs within a few steps and making the complete outdoor cooking experience more fluid.

- Phase 1: The Utility Audit. Before any design is finalized, we map all underground utilities. I've seen projects halted for weeks because a gas line was in the proposed location. We must confirm the locations for running a dedicated gas line, water supply, drainage, and at least two separate electrical conduits.
- Phase 2: Foundation and Framing. The kitchen needs a proper concrete footing, not just a paver patio base, to prevent shifting. I insist on galvanized steel framing instead of wood. It's non-combustible and won't rot or warp, adding decades to the structure's life.
- Phase 3: Zonal Component Placement. This is where the framework becomes reality. We install the cabinet structure and place the grill and appliances in their designated zones. Install the Hot Zone components first along one leg. Then, install the sink and refrigerator on the other. This locks in the workflow before any finishing materials are applied.
- Phase 4: Countertop Templating. A critical error is ordering countertops from the initial blueprint. I always have the templating done after the base structure is fully built and appliances are on site. This ensures a perfect fit and accounts for any minor framing variances.
- Phase 5: Final Hookups and System Test. Once countertops are in, all utilities are connected. We perform a full system check: a gas line leak test using a manometer, a full water pressure test on the plumbing, and a load test on the electrical circuits to ensure they don't trip under full use.
